Md. firefighters rescue girl from 30-foot well

The 10-year-old girl fell down the well and was rescued about half an hour later; she was flown to a hospital with non-life threatening injuries

PASADENA, Md. — Authorities in Anne Arundel County say a 10-year-old girl has been rescued after a fall down a 30-foot well in Pasadena.

Anne Arundel County Fire Division Chief Keith Swindle says the girl fell down the well Monday afternoon and was rescued about half an hour later.

Capt. Michael Pfaltzgraff says it appears deteriorated plywood covering the hole collapsed under the girl. He says the hole is about three feet in diameter, wide enough for a firefighter to be lowered to the bottom. Pfaltzgraff says a rescuer attached a securing device to the girl and they were lifted to the surface together.

Officials say the girl was flown to Johns Hopkins Hospital in Baltimore with injuries that were not considered life threatening, including hypothermia.
